J. Hastings (Peoria)
1851Business directory advert for "J. Hastings, Resident Daguerrian Artist, Colored Daguerreotype Miniatures Taken in a Superior Style"
Advert
Peoria Historical SocietyJ. Hastings,
Resident Daguerrian Artist,
Colored Daguerreotype Miniatures Taken in a Superior Style.
Likenesses taken in a few seconds, from seven o'clock, A. M., to six P. M., in any kind of weather. All pictures warranted durable and satisfactory to the persons sitting.
Prices, from ONE DOLLAR AND FIFTY CENTS to EIGHT DOLLARS, according to style, for single pictures.
Rooms over William Allen Herron's Drug Store, Corner of Main and Washington Streets.
Ladies and gentlemen are invited to call and examine specimens.
Instruction given in the art, and apparatus for sale.
Peoria, March 1st, 1851.
Published in: S. DE Witt Drown, 1850,
Drown's Record & Historical Review of Peoria, from the Discovery by the French Jesuit Missionaries in the Seventeenth Century, To the Present Time, Also An Almanac for 1851, To Which is Added A Business Directory of the City, With Business Cards LL/68734
